About

Jinxi Lin is a scholar working on Molecular Biology, Epidemiology and Organic Chemistry. According to data from OpenAlex, Jinxi Lin has authored 20 papers receiving a total of 962 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 5 papers in Epidemiology and 4 papers in Organic Chemistry. Recurrent topics in Jinxi Lin's work include Acute Ischemic Stroke Management (5 papers), Cephalopods and Marine Biology (3 papers) and Antiplatelet Therapy and Cardiovascular Diseases (3 papers). Jinxi Lin is often cited by papers focused on Acute Ischemic Stroke Management (5 papers), Cephalopods and Marine Biology (3 papers) and Antiplatelet Therapy and Cardiovascular Diseases (3 papers). Jinxi Lin collaborates with scholars based in Taiwan, China and United Kingdom. Jinxi Lin's co-authors include Shoei‐Yn Lin‐Shiau, Yu‐Chih Liang, Ming‐Yung Chou, Chi‐Jane Wang, Shih‐Hung Tsai, Yuan‐Soon Ho, Jia‐Yush Yen, Jong‐Tseng Yen, Yi‐Chin Lin and Yongjun Wang and has published in prestigious journals such as JNCI Journal of the National Cancer Institute, Clinical Chemistry and European Journal of Cancer.
